## Static-Analysis Baseline — Lintharbor

Lintharbor compares each scan against the committed baseline file at `analysis/baseline.json`. If the baseline is stale, builds fail with exit code 42. Regenerate with `lintharbor --rebaseline` and commit the result. On-call: do not suppress findings manually; rebaseline only after triage. Baseline uploads to the Corvex artifact store are authenticated, and the upload token is set in the env file on the line that follows this sentence.

vault entry, yahaf-tagug: LEDGER_TOKEN20=884d77d1a8b98aa4edfb

Capacity note for the Fennelgrid sidecar review. Aggregation window widened to cut emit rate; per-pod memory ceiling holds at current cardinality (~12k series). CPU flat. Risk: buffer overflow if a tenant spikes labels — mitigated by the drop policy. No node-pool changes needed for the Caldermoor cluster this quarter. Review the flush and buffer settings before merge. Constants under review are below.

limits module of yafop-hahag:
QUOTAS = {
    "tamwyn": 652,
    "prawyn": 731,
}

TICKET-4821: Memory leak in Pixelhold image cache. The Snapgrove thumbnail service retains decoded bitmaps after eviction; heap grows ~40MB/hour under normal load. Repro: cycle 500 gallery images, watch RSS climb. Workaround for support: restart the render worker nightly until patched. Fix lands in the next Pixelhold point release; affected customers should not enable aggressive prefetch. The leaking build is identified by the token below.

session token of tajef-bageg = htk21_5d90d574934f3ccae6437

[ ] Confirm offline mode compatibility for all registered plugins before the Fernline field-survey release ships. Plugins must queue writes locally when connectivity drops and replay them in submission order on reconnect. Any plugin calling the sync endpoint directly will break in airplane scenarios — use the provided queue adapter instead. Test against the staging bundle and record results, verifying you tested the exact artifact noted below.

pipeline stamp: htk4_ae36